Tiny Wheels is a VR sandbox where you can create tracks and steer a remote control car through your creations. There's no rules, no score, no objective. You can create challenging tracks and see if you can navigate your tiny car through it or just enjoy the act of creating.

Gameplay: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=r5HpeC_gxE8 Tiny Wheels is a really fun game and my expectations were literally crushed (in a positive way). The sandbox environment works really well and it is easy enough to get into to be useful for VR showcases. For example, yesterday I had my grandfather over and he expressed ecstatic, childlike joy while building and playing with the car (lol). PROS - Simple, easy to get into, good for VR showcases. - Exceeded my expectations. The controls felt very similar to controlling an RC car in real life. - The scalability option is outstanding. Works similar to Google Earth VR if you've tried that. - It's not just for kids, or maybe it is, either way I found it quite enjoyable (at least when considering how cheap it is). CONS - Play other people's tracks. - Custom objects. For example, it would be useful if there was an option to create custom ramps (or just objects in general). For example, options to change its size, slope, color etc. - Or just add some more objects. - First-person driver (I know it's being worked on so that is obviously great!)

Very basic, but entertaining, havent been any recent updates, so im guessing its completed/abandoned. You can only build in a flat level, you have few items ~13 and only 1 car. Its super kid friendly, while i understand its a "make your own fun" game, it would have been nice for some premade levels to be included. For the price its hard to ask for more.

This game is worth every penny and beyond! It might be a little light on the track pieces, but scaling and being able to rotate them in any direction adds some more depth to building. If you ever played with toy cars as a kid, this game will bring you back to those days. Fun for any age, easy to pick up, and creates great moments that keep you wanting to do more. The only nitpicks I have are: - The driving is a little tough to master, but it does add to the fun - An option to snap/align track pieces would be awesome I'd say this game could definitely use multiplayer, but as it stands right now, it works just fine the way it is.

Had a bunch of fun with this one and my kids loved the car crashes :) Some suggestions for improvements: * make grabbing easier - it's pretty finicky about where you can grab pieces and my 4yr old daughter had the most trouble with this * snapping - being able to snap pieces of track together would be amazing as they're a bit hard to line up * first person driving point of view - be in the driver's seat!
